Charlie Watts

by Scott Yanow
On first glance, Charlie Watts would seem to be a funny choice to include in a jazz book for he is the longtime drummer of The Rolling Stones. However, jazz was Watts' first love and in the 1980s he toured worldwide with a huge big band that included many of England's top musicians (giving one a chance to hear Evan Parker play "Lester Leaps In!"). In 1991, he organized an excellent bop quintet (featuring altoist Peter King) that paid tribute to Charlie Parker, justifying Watts' place in any jazz history book. ~ Scott Yanow, All Music Guide
